    The SAP error message FSH_PP_ORD015: No components available for display typically occurs in the context of production planning and control, particularly when dealing with production orders or planned orders in the SAP system. This error indicates that the system cannot find any components associated with the order you are trying to display.
    Causes:
    
    
    No Components Assigned: The production order or planned order does not have any components assigned to it. This could happen if the bill of materials (BOM) is not correctly set up or if the order was created without specifying components.
    
    
    Incorrect Order Type: The order type being used may not be configured to include components, or it may not be relevant for the type of production being executed.
    
    
    BOM Issues: The BOM for the material may not exist, or it may not be valid for the specific plant or production version being used.
